概括
对于训练有素和未训练有素的检查员来说,一种用于眼睛折射的新组合装置是可靠和高效的. 这个ZEISS VISUCORE 500系统提供准确的客观和主观测量,改善临床工作流程.
科学领域:
- 眼科和眼镜检查的眼科和眼镜检查
- 医疗器械和仪器仪表 医疗器械和仪器仪表
背景情况:
- 准确的折射误差评估对于最佳视力校正至关重要.
- 传统的折射方法可能耗时,需要专门的专业知识.
- 评估新型设备的效率和准确性对于推进眼科护理至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 评估一种新的组合器件 (ZEISS VISUCORE 500),用于客观和主观的眼睛折射.
- 评估其可重复性,可复制性,有效性,视觉质量和时间.
- 为了比较经验丰富和未经培训的考员之间的表现.
主要方法:
- 六名检查人员 (3名受过培训,3名未受过培训) 对33名健康参与者进行了客观和主观折射.
- 将ZEISS VISUCORE 500 (VC) 与常规方法 (波面异常计和光镜) 相比较.
- 关键指标包括可重复性,可重复性,最佳校正视敏度和手术时间.
主要成果:
- 对于客观的球体等效 (SE) 测量,VC显示出良好的重复性和可重复性.
- 与VC的主观折射也显示出良好的重复性和可重复性,与对照组相比.
- 没有发现最佳校正视力敏度的显著差异;VC引导模式是最有效的时间 (<5分钟).
结论:
- 齐斯VISUCORE 500提供可靠和高效的客观和主观折射.
- 该设备在训练有素和未训练有素的考员中表现一致.
- 这种组合设备有可能简化眼科检查过程.

Systematic Error: Methodological and Sampling Errors
In the case of systematic errors, the sources can be identified, and the errors can be subsequently minimized by addressing these sources. According to the source, systematic errors can be divided into sampling, instrumental, methodological, and personal errors.
Sampling errors originate from improper sampling methods or the wrong sample population. These errors can be minimized by refining the sampling strategy. Defective instruments or faulty calibrations are the sources of instrumental...

Quality Assurance
Quality assurance is the overarching term used to describe the activities employed to ensure the proper performance of a system. These activities can be classified into three categories: quality control, quality assessment, and internal corrective measures. Typically, these activities work cyclically: quality control is performed before and during the analysis, while quality assessment occurs during and after the investigation.
